... Read MoreThings I liked:Rock solid construction. Looks great, too. Fit & finish rival that of similarly (and higher!) priced center fire rifles. I particularly like the unusual, but comfortable, shape of the RH pistol grip. Hole-in-hole accuracy--I've never shot groups this tight, before! Things I would have changed:I'd like to have a safety that could be re-engaged without having to use the cocking lever. What others should know:This gun is heavy! It would be a challenge for me to hold it steady, for long, in a standing position. This is definitely no "kids" gun.

... Read MoreThings I liked:Well, it does look pretty cool...but.... Things I would have changed:Better sights would be a plus. And for those with no intention of using this gun without telescopic sights, it would be nice if they could be removed altogether. The fiber optics were completely useless in the low light conditions that I was shooting in. What others should know:My low rating is due to the excessive barrel droop on this gun. Given the otherwise high ratings for this gun, I suspect I simply got a Monday or Friday model ;-) I attempted to sight in at 15 ft, but the POI was already 4" low. At the maximum scope adjustment, the best I could do was 3 1/4" low POI at 30 ft. I will say that the groupings weren't too shabby, though! I punted on the scope and decided to see what I could do with the open sights. I had to crank that baby out to the limit of travel, too, but I finally got impacts that were just about right. The groupings suffered--possibly because the sight was unstable cranked all the way up?? But I suspect that my eyesight (>50), shooting skill, and fatigue probably all contributed a bit, too.
